Output 16436fff0daac73476aa9184edfbb97685b0e67056e5a1b6fa082345e3eeaee1:1

value
269413213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68d7d7f479c9446b6d95319a6ce5bb666dfb38f2 OP_EQUAL
address
3BFNmZvui9V82Tb6Hxx2JZqKhDuWxLeh7j
transaction
16436fff0daac73476aa9184edfbb97685b0e67056e5a1b6fa082345e3eeaee1
confirmations
301703
spent
true